Mark Lajal is a professional tennis player from Estonia, born 12 May 2003. The Estonian competes on the ATP Tour and plays right-handed. Lajal stands 191 cm (6 ft 3 in) tall. Lajal reached a career-high singles ranking of World No. 145 in 2025. Among ATP players under 24, Lajal is ranked No. 39. Lajal has been strongest on grass, winning 65% of matches (20-11), ahead of hard (60%, 131-88) and clay (44%, 11-14). The Estonian was born in Tallinn.
